Teorian zure ordenagailuaren arkitektura dagoeneko jakin beharko zenuke lehenik Linux instalatu duzulako.
Jakina, Linux ordenagailuan instalatu ez zenezake eta arkitektura ezagutu behar duzu paketea exekutatu aurretik.
Uste duzu arkitektura mota hori begi bistakoa dela, baina Chromebook-ak kontuan hartzen badituzu, x86_64 edo besoa oinarritzen den aukera bat da eta ez da zertan argirik ordenagailu bat bilatzen duen ala ez, 32-bit edo 64- bit.
Beraz, zer mota daude? Baita Debian deskargatzeko orriek egiaztatzen dituztela honako arkitekturak zerrendatzen:
- amd64
- ARM64
- armel
- armhf
- i386
- MIPS
- mipsel
- PowerPC
- ppc64el
- s390ex
Beste arkitektura potentzial batzuk i486, i586, i686, ia64, alfa eta sparc dira.
Hurrengo komandoa zure ordenagailurako arkitektura erakutsiko dizu:
arku
Funtsean, komandoa komandoa adierazteko era sinple bat da:
uname -m
Uname bat zure ordenagailuari buruzko informazio mota guztiak inprimatzeko erabiltzen da, hau da, arkitektura mota txiki bat da.
Sinplea bere ikonoetan idaztea besterik ez duzu exekutatzen ari zaren sistema eragilea, hau da, Linux, berriz, uname -a-ek komando bateko informazio guztia erakusten du, honako hauek barne:
- kernel izena
- nodoaren izena
- kernel askatzea
- kernel bertsioa
- makina hardware (hau da, komandoaren arearen antzekoa)
- prozesadorea
- hardware plataforma
- sistema eragilea
Konmutadoreak erabil ditzakezu erakutsi nahi duzun informazioa zehazteko.
- uname -a - informazio guztia erakusten du
- uname -s - kernel (hau da, Linux) erakusten du
- uname -n - sare ostalari izena (hau da, localhost.localdomain) erakusten du
- uname -r - kernelaren oharra (hau da, 3.10.0-229.14.1.e17.x86_64) erakusten du
- uname -v - kernel bertsioa erakusten du (hau da, # 1 SMP Tue Sep 15 15:05:51 UTC 2015)
- uname -m - arkitektura erakusten du (hau da, x86_64)
- uname -p - prozesadore mota erakusten du (hau da, x86_64)
- uname -i - hardware plataforma (hau da, x86_64)
- uname -o - sistema eragilea
Uname eta arkuaren eskuliburu osoa ikus dezakezu komando hau idazten baduzu:
info coreutils 'uname invocation'
Era berean, arku komandoaren xehetasun guztiak lortzeko aukera ematen du, man arkuarekin idazten baduzu.
Arku komandoak 2 aldatzaile bakarrik ditu:
- arch --help - erakutsi laguntza orria
- arch --version - bertsioaren zenbakia bistaratu
Gida hau osatzeko komando hau ere erakutsiko dizu zure sistema 32 bit edo 64 bit-eko exekutatzen ari den ala ez:
- getconf LONG_BIT
getconf benetan konfigurazioaren balioa da. POSIX programatzaileen eskuliburuaren zati da. LONG_BITek osoko zenbaki oso baten tamaina itzultzen du. 32 itzultzen badituzu, 32 biteko sistema duzu, berriz 64 funtzioak 64 biteko sistema bat baduzu.
Metodo hau ez da ergela, ordea, eta agian ez da arkitektura guztietan lan egitea.
Getconf komando mota man getconf buruzko xehetasun guztiak terminal leiho batean edo bisitatu web orri hau.
Argi dago arku bat baino errazago itxi behar dela -m bezalako komandoak nabarmentzekoa da arch komandoa zaharkituta geratu dela eta agian ez dago erabilgarri Linuxen bertsio guztietan etorkizunean. Orduan komando bat erabiliz erabili beharko zenuke.